- > I've ftp from sgi.com pcnfsd which has worked fine for serving the SGI-attached
- > disks to pcs, but I've been unable to configure the SGI to allow pcs to
- > print on SGI-attached printers. Since pcnfsd is not supported by SGI I was
- > not too surprised that TAC could provide no help. Can anybody on the net
- > provide guidance on printing to SGI-attached printers via pcnfsd?
-
- Which printing service are you using, the bsd lpr utilities or lp? I
- think the pcnfsd
- as compiled defaults to 'lp -c', but may be extended by using a
- printcap file in /etc,
- i.e. /etc/printcap. This method of defining printers should be
- described in the pcnfsd(8c)
- man page included with the pcnfsd executable.
